    Who is Dr. Alford, Orthopedic Surgeon in Warwick, RI?

    Dr. John Alford, MD is an Orthopedic Surgeon, who primarily practices in Warwick, RI with 1 additional practice location. He has been practicing for over 22 years and is board certified by the American Board of Orthopaedic Surgery. Dr. Alford graduated from The Warren Alpert Medical School of Brown University and completed his residency at Rush-Presby-St Luke'S M C, Sports Medicine-Orthopedic Surgery; Rhode Island Hosp-Lifespan, Orthopedic Surgery; Rhode Island Hosp-Lifespan, General Surgery. Dr. Alford is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Alford’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. John Alford's specialty?

    Dr. Alford is a Orthopedic Surgeon near Warwick, RI. An orthopedic surgeon has specialization in preserving, investigating, and restoring the form and function of the extremities, spine, and related structures through medical, surgical, and physical methods. They care for patients with musculoskeletal issues, including congenital deformities, trauma, infections, tumors, metabolic disturbances, and degenerative diseases affecting the spine, hands, feet, knees, hips, shoulders, and elbows in both children and adults. Additionally, orthopedic surgeons address primary and secondary muscular problems and the impact of central or peripheral nervous system lesions on the musculoskeletal system.
